Join the Central West District as we hear Adam Hamilton present his new book: Wrestling with Doubt, Finding Faith at Smyrna First United Methodist Church on Wednesday, April 10 from 7 to 9 pm.

Rev. Adam Hamilton is the founding pastor of Resurrection United Methodist Church in the Kansas City area. 

Hamilton was named one of the “Ten people to watch in America’s spiritual landscape” by Religion and Ethics Newsweekly. For his efforts in Kansas City, he has been recognized with the first Founder’s Civility Award by American Public Square at Jewell.  

Hamilton has written over 35 books including with Abingdon, Random House, Harper Collins and others.  Titles include Wrestling with Doubt, Finding FaithLuke: Jesus and the Outsiders, Outcasts, and Outlaws, The Lord’s Prayer, Seeing Gray in a World of Black and White, and Making Sense of the Bible. Adam and LaVon have been married over 40 years and have two adult daughters and a granddaughter.
